The Science of Creatine Absorption
Creatine is a nitrogenous organic acid that plays a critical role in cellular energy production. When you take a creatine supplement, it travels through your digestive system to be absorbed into the bloodstream. This absorption process is facilitated by specialized transporters in the gut, which actively move the creatine from the intestines into circulation. Once in the blood, the creatine is primarily transported to muscle cells, where it is stored as phosphocreatine. This stored phosphocreatine is then used to rapidly regenerate adenosine triphosphate (ATP), the body's primary energy currency, during high-intensity exercise. For this system to be optimized, creatine must be readily available and effectively absorbed.
The Fate of Undissolved Powder
So, what happens if you swallow undissolved creatine powder? The good news is that your stomach acid is powerful enough to break down the particles and dissolve them. The creatine will still reach your intestines and be absorbed by the body. The issue, however, lies in the efficiency and comfort of this process. When creatine is not fully dissolved, it draws water from the body into the intestines during digestion. This can lead to gastrointestinal issues such as stomach cramps, bloating, and diarrhea, especially if you're taking a high dose or are not properly hydrated. Essentially, while the undissolved powder will eventually be absorbed, the journey is less comfortable and potentially less efficient than if it were fully mixed into a solution.
Micronized vs. Standard Creatine Monohydrate
The distinction between different forms of creatine, particularly standard versus micronized creatine monohydrate, is a key factor in solubility and user experience.
| Feature | Standard Creatine Monohydrate | Micronized Creatine Monohydrate |
|---|---|---|
| Particle Size | Larger, standard-sized crystals | Finely processed into smaller particles (up to 20 times smaller) |
| Solubility | Moderate; often leaves sediment or clumps in liquid | Enhanced; dissolves more completely and easily |
| Potential Side Effects | Higher chance of mild bloating or digestive upset, especially during loading phases | Reduced risk of gastrointestinal discomfort due to better dissolution |
| Absorption Rate | Standard absorption | Slightly faster initial absorption due to larger surface area, but ultimately provides the same muscle saturation over time |
| Effectiveness | Highly effective and backed by decades of research | Equally effective; the main benefits are improved mixability and reduced digestive issues, not superior results |
| Cost | Typically more affordable | Slightly more expensive due to additional processing |
How Micronization Impacts Absorption
Micronized creatine's smaller particle size gives it a greater surface area, which allows it to dissolve more rapidly and completely in liquid. This leads to faster initial absorption and a smoother ingestion experience, minimizing the chances of stomach upset for sensitive individuals. However, multiple studies confirm that for long-term muscle saturation and overall performance benefits, both forms are equally effective. The choice primarily comes down to personal preference regarding mixability, digestive tolerance, and budget.
How to Maximize Creatine Absorption and Minimize Side Effects
To ensure you get the most out of your creatine supplement, follow these best practices:
- Mix thoroughly: Use a sufficient amount of water or other liquid (at least 12 fl. oz per 5 grams) and stir or shake well to fully dissolve the powder.
- Consider liquid temperature: Creatine dissolves more easily in warmer liquids, but cold liquids work too—they just require more agitation.
- Pair with carbohydrates: Consuming creatine with carbohydrates, like fruit juice or a carb-rich meal, can help enhance absorption. The resulting insulin spike helps shuttle creatine into muscle cells more efficiently.
- Timing with protein: A post-workout shake containing protein and carbs is an excellent way to take creatine, as it maximizes absorption and supports muscle recovery.
- Consume immediately: While not a strict rule, consuming your creatine drink shortly after mixing is best. Over time, creatine can break down into creatinine in liquid, especially in acidic drinks, though the effect is minimal in the short term.
The Role of Consistent Intake
Ultimately, creatine works by saturating your muscle stores over time, not through a single, instantaneous effect. Whether you opt for a loading phase (20g/day for 5-7 days) or a steady daily dose (3-5g), the goal is to consistently top up your muscles' creatine levels. The speed of initial absorption from a single dose is less critical than the long-term, consistent intake that maintains muscle saturation. Even if undissolved particles are absorbed slightly less efficiently in the very short term, daily consumption ensures stores are eventually filled and maintained.
Proper Hydration is Crucial
Regardless of how you consume your creatine, staying well-hydrated is essential. Creatine draws water into your muscle cells, and while this is a key part of its function, it also means your body needs sufficient fluids to prevent dehydration. An extra 24-32 fl. oz of water per day beyond your normal intake is a good rule of thumb when supplementing. Adequate hydration also helps mitigate the potential digestive side effects associated with undissolved powder.
